Get Max Money
When You look at 'Cargo Payment Rates', they pay You for each
10 units of cargo over a distance of 20 squares. If You place
(for example) an lorry station next to a coalmine, then a
bus station in a square next to it, the station occupies two
squares, but it is the same station. You build a railroad
(RR)-station in the next square, You remove the bus station
and build a new bus station on the other side of the RR-station,
You remove the RR-station and build a new RR-station at the
other side of the bus station, and You continue doing this,
the stations ORIGINAL position will remain, but You keep on
moving the bus station and the RR-station until You get just
out of reach of a coal mine. THERE You place the RR-station.
You build a new station in reach of the coal mine, build a
train (or a ship or lorry) to carry the coal, then You will
have a transport route which doesn't last very long (hehe),
and because of transporting the coal over that long distance,
You will get MAXIMUM PAYMENT!!! BUT REMEMBER: the lorry station
on the stations ORIGINAL position must NOT be removed.You
can also transport any other material this way.
